3

Ubuntu サーバー用にヘッドレス Firefox ブラウザーをセットアップしようとしています。他の投稿の指示に従いましたが、何も機能していないようです。Firefox を起動しようとすると、このエラーが発生します。

~(branch:master*) » firefox                                                                                                                                                                     jake@ubuntu
Error: no display specified
------------------------------------------------------------
~(branch:master*) » phpunit functional/SiteTest.php                                                                                                                                             jake@ubuntu
------------------------------------------------------------
~(branch:master*) » export DISPLAY=:10                                                                                                                                                          jake@ubuntu
------------------------------------------------------------
~(branch:master*) » firefox                                                                                                                                                                     jake@ubuntu
Error: cannot open display: :10

ディスプレイドライバーに問題があるに違いないと思います。

これらは私が従う指示です。

http://www.installationpage.com/selenium/how-to-run-selenium-headless-firefox-in-ubuntu/

詳細が必要な場合はお知らせください。

4

2 に答える 2

1

インストールxvfbパッケージ:

sudo apt-get install xvfb

次に、Firefox を次のように実行します。

xvfb-run firefox
于 2015-04-19T17:19:07.327 に答える
0

新しいUbuntu 16.04.1に、Firefoxをインストールしました。これはうまくいきませんでした

Couldn't open libGL.so.1: libGL.so.1: cannot open shared object file: No such file or directory

dfed xvfbをインストールしました

sudo apt-get install xvfb

そしてFirefoxを起動しました

firefox

これはうまくいきました。-X を使用して ssh ログインすることに注意してください

ssh -X user@your_headless_box

Xアプリケーションを表示できるホスト上に何かを持っています。Windows ではおそらく Xming、Mac では XQuartz

于 2016-10-17T13:03:54.013 に答える